The NRE 3GS24C is a genset locomotive manufactured by National Railway Equipment Company, Paducah, Kentucky for use in Australia.
History
Five members of the class were built for El Zorro. However before they had left the United States, El Zorro collapsed.
In May 2013, two were unloaded at Port Kembla as demonstrators.
After being demonstrated, they were stored at Broadmeadow. In December 2014, they were hauled to Islington Railway Workshops and are scheduled to enter service with Balco Australia hauling containerised hay trains from Bowmans. The other three remain in store in the United States.
